Output c84b02758513214edcc60eadd66e789e77752e227b7c88f7e179d7b181b9535d:1

value
39889116
script pubkey
OP_0 OP_PUSHBYTES_20 6f2d009c59664c90bb36b8b6dd0a9f23cd220bf1
address
bc1qduksp8zevexfpwekhzmd6z5ly0xjyzl3fqq2fe
transaction
c84b02758513214edcc60eadd66e789e77752e227b7c88f7e179d7b181b9535d
spent
true